Marit Rismark
Institution: Norwegian University of Science and Technology (NTNU)
Country: Norway
Professor Marit Rismark’s research areas are conditions for learning in higher education and work. The focus is on new approaches to learning in higher education, as well as the design of teaching practices in higher education that prepare students to fill key roles in workplaces.
A main assumption is that what adults need or want to learn, which opportunities that are available, and the way they learn are determined by their sociocultural context. Adults find themselves in a sociocultural context influenced by the three main forces demography, technology and globalization. Continuous changes influence learning needs throughout the life span in general and in particular the learning needs in higher education and work.
